What Causes This Problem
- Water intrusion from storms or plumbing leaks can severely weaken structural elements.
- Termite infestations cause extensive, hidden damage to wood framing over time.
- Fire incidents can compromise load-bearing walls and roofs, requiring expert repair.
- Extended mold growth beneath surfaces deteriorates wood and drywall integrity.
- Improper ventilation accelerates moisture buildup, harming structural materials.
Rockwall’s proximity to Lake Ray Hubbard means homes frequently face humid conditions that encourage structural moisture damage. Professionals often see cases where mold and other environmental factors undermine building strength. What Signs Indicate A Full Structural Restoration Is Needed?
If you notice sagging floors, cracks in walls, or water damage to framing, a full structural restoration may be required to address hidden issues and prevent further deterioration.
How Long Does A Full Structural Restoration Typically Take?
Project length varies by damage extent, but most full structural restorations in Rockwall complete within several weeks to ensure proper repairs and inspections.
